HAMILTON MAN SPARED JAIL AFTER SEXUAL ASSAULT CONVICTION
David Buchanan Murray, residing on Hillhead Crescent, was found guilty of sexually assaulting a woman inside a residence in Hamilton.
He stripped her of her clothing, engaged in sexual assault, and recorded her while she was unable to consent or refuse.
After he denied the charges and presented a special defence asserting consent, the jury reached a majority verdict of guilt.
He was sentenced to 18 months of supervision, required to complete 250 hours of unpaid community service within six months, and was registered on the Sex Offenders’ Register for a period of 18 months.
